What is the Tax Credit Recertification Checklist?
The Tax Credit Recertification Checklist is a crucial document for property management, designed to ensure that the income and eligibility of residents are accurately verified for tax credit programs. This checklist plays a vital role in maintaining compliance and providing necessary housing support to qualified individuals.
Verification of resident income and eligibility is essential in tax credit programs, as it directly influences access to housing assistance. The checklist serves as a systematic approach, allowing property managers to streamline this important process.

What are the eligibility requirements for the Tax Credit Recertification Checklist?
Eligibility typically includes residents who have participated in tax credit programs and must verify their income annually. Check with your property management for specific criteria.
Are there any deadlines to consider when submitting this checklist?
Yes, it is essential to submit the checklist by the annual recertification date set by your property management to maintain your eligibility for tax credits.
What submission methods are available for this form?
The form can be submitted electronically through pdfFiller or printed and submitted in person or via mail as per property management guidelines.
What documents are required to complete the checklist?
Required supporting documents typically include income verification records, prior certifications, and any relevant financial statements that demonstrate eligibility.
What are common mistakes to avoid when filling out the checklist?
Common mistakes include incomplete fields, missed signatures, and failure to provide required documentation. Always double-check for completeness before submission.
How long does processing take after submitting the checklist?
Processing times can vary, but typically it takes a few weeks to review and approve. Contact your property management for specific processing timeframes.
